CGW445449 Counsel for the Defense (The Advocate), c.1862-65 (pen & ink, charcoal, crayon & w/c on paper) by Daumier, Honore (1808-79); 51.7x60.3 cm; Corcoran Collection, National Gallery of Art, Washington D.C. USA; William A. Clark Collection; French, out of copyright

The captivating print "Counsel for the Defense (The Advocate)" by Honore Daumier takes us back to the mid-19th century, immersing us in a scene of legal drama and intrigue. This remarkable artwork showcases Daumier's mastery of pen and ink, charcoal, crayon, and watercolor on paper. In this composition, we witness a pivotal moment during a trial as the defense lawyer passionately argues his case. The male lawyer stands tall and confident, gesturing emphatically with conviction. His eloquence is evident as he fights for justice on behalf of his client. Seated opposite him is a female defendant who listens intently to her advocate's every word. Her expression reveals both hope and anxiety as she places her trust in the hands of her skilled counsel. Daumier skillfully captures not only the characters but also their surroundings within an interior courtroom setting. Every detail – from the wooden furniture to the solemn atmosphere – adds authenticity to this compelling narrative. This artwork serves as a testament to Daumier's ability to depict human emotions through his artistry while shedding light on themes of law, justice, and equality. As we gaze upon this timeless piece from the Corcoran Collection at the National Gallery of Art in Washington D. C. , we are transported into an era where legal battles were fought with fervor and determination.
